    What does a Gastroenterologist do?

    An internist focused on diagnosing and treating disorders of the digestive system, encompassing the stomach, intestines, liver, and gallbladder. This specialist manages conditions like abdominal pain, ulcers, diarrhea, cancer, and jaundice, and performs intricate diagnostic and therapeutic procedures using endoscopes to examine internal organs.

    Is this Dr. Sezen Altug affiliated with a ranked Castle Connolly Top Hospital?

    Yes, Dr. Altug is affiliated with Houston Physicians' Hospital, Hca Houston Healthcare Clear Lake, Houston Methodist Clear Lake Hospital which are a Castle Connolly Top Hospitals. Castle Connolly Top Hospitals are healthcare institutions recognized for their excellence in specific medical procedures and overall patient care. They are identified through a rigorous peer nomination process, evaluating factors like patient outcomes, quality of care, and expertise. The list recognizes hospitals that excel in 20 or more specific medical procedures, representing the top 25% nationwide. Castle Connolly Top Hospitals
